Food coops and chicken coops

When I was of an age to watch Sesame St, the buzz word for children was "cooperation" (nowadays it seems to be "resilience").

It always puzzled me why this word had "oo" that didn't sound the usual way, as in "boot" or "book", and then later I wondered why it had no hyphen on TV the way I'd seen it sometimes on paper.

Years later when I joined a bread-making co-op (super-healthy wholegrain loaves, hard as rocks, delivered by bicycle. Such hippies) I would insist on segmenting "co-op" with a hyphen, not "coop". A coop was always a place to keep chickens, in my book.

The food co-op where I refill my shampoo and detergent bottles (yup, still a bit of a hippie) still has a hypen, but hyphens are dropping out of this and other words fast elsewhere, giving us potential segment-ups like reelect, prearrange and microorganism.

However, hyphens are still essential for segmenting many other words – you can't really write "co-own" or "anti-inflammatory" or "re-sorting" without one. I would like to add a something to segment the syllables in "skiing" and "Shiite", but I'm not sure what. And if I'm working with you, please don't call me your "coworker", I grew up on a dairy farm.

One sound or two?

Once you start looking for them, there are heaps of words that look like they contain a familiar vowel spelling representing a single sound, but in fact you need to segment them into separate syllables, as they are working independently to represent separate sounds.

Consider "antidote" and "", "comely" and "comedy", "boing" and "", "polecat" and "polemic", "bean" and "" (the links take you to wordlists with more examples).

We can't just go sticking hyphens in words like stoic, , caveat or (am I the only one who thinks it should be "zooology"? Maybe that's just my accent) but segmenting them can be tricky for beginners.

Perhaps we could use the diaeresis, like the words "naïve" and "Noël", the Brontës and aspirational Chloës and Zoës. Chicken coop but food coöp. Looks a bit weird though, not very English.

Pre-segmented or not, these patterns should be learnt

Whether we retain hyphens and/or use diaereses or not (the does the latter), learners need to be taught that sometimes, even though letters seem to be working together to represent a single sound, they're not.

My Filipino friend Neri enjoys pointing this out each Christmas by admiring the "shefferds". Not sure what the New Yorker style manual says about this particular "ph", or  the "th" in "hothead" and "rathole" and the "sh" in "dishonest" and "ramshorns". Should we segment them more clearly? Did we do so previously, but then slacked off?

A comprehensive spelling curriculum needs to identify and practice less common patterns like these, once the major patterns are established.

Too often, only the main patterns are taught, and learners are left wondering about and tripping over the rest.

A good coop for thee to 4 birds ought to cost you in the region of ₤ 300 though this can rely on whether you choose for a free standing house or one with a run attached. Presuming you are ranging your birds in a huge room and the pop hole door is big sufficient for the type you maintain, after that the main requirements of housing come down to three points which will certainly specify the variety of birds your home will hold; perches, nest boxes as well as ventilation. Most breeds of chicken will perch when they go to roost at night, this perch must ideally be 5-8cm vast with smoothed off sides so the foot rests easily on it. The perch must be above the nest box entry as chickens will likewise normally seek the highest point to perch. A perch less than that will have the birds roosting in the nest box over night (which is by the way when they create one of the most poo) causing stained eggs the list below day. They should not nevertheless be so high off the flooring of your home that leg injuries might happen when the bird gets down in the early morning. Chickens need regarding 20cm of perch each (in small types this is clearly much less), plus if greater than one perch is set up in your home they need to be more than 30cm apart. They will hunker up with their next-door neighbors yet are not that crazy about roosting with a beak in the bloomers of the bird ahead. Ideally your house ought to have a the very least one nest box for every single three birds as well as these need to be off the ground and also in the darkest area of your house. Your home must have adequate air flow: without it after that condensation will accumulate every night, also in the chilliest of weather condition. Realize, ventilation works on the concept of warm and comfortable air leaving through a high space drawing cooler air in from a lower gap - it's not a set of openings on contrary walls of your house and also at the same degree, this is what's referred to as a draft.
